About this event

High-income earners frequently make costly Medicare enrollment errors that result in permanent penalties, inadequate coverage, or unnecessarily high premiums. IRMAA surcharges, late enrollment penalties, and misunderstanding of employer coverage coordination create expensive mistakes that compound over retirement years. These errors often stem from assumptions about Medicare that don't apply to high earners or misconceptions about employer retiree coverage.

This session identifies the most common Medicare mistakes made by affluent retirees and provides strategies to navigate enrollment successfully. We'll examine IRMAA income thresholds, employer coverage coordination rules, and supplement insurance decisions that frequently trip up high earners. You'll learn how to time Medicare enrollment correctly, understand the true costs of different coverage options, and make informed decisions that optimize both coverage and costs throughout retirement.
